Jubail Energy Services Company

Jubail Energy Services Company (JESCO), headquartered in Saudi Arabia, is a leading player in the energy sector, specialising in the provision of comprehensive eng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) services. Established in 1998, JESCO has made significant strides in the industry, focusing on oil and gas, petrochemicals, and power generation, with operations extending across the Gulf region. JESCO's core offerings include project management, maintenance services, and innovative solutions tailored to meet the unique demands of its clients. The company is recognised for its commitment to quality and safety, which has solidified its position as a trusted partner in the energy landscape. With a strong track record of successful projects, JESCO continues to drive advancements in energy services, contributing to the region's economic growth and sustainability initiatives.

Jubail Energy Services Company's reported carbon emissions

Jubail Energy Services Company, headquartered in Saudi Arabia, currently does not have publicly available carbon emissions data for the most recent year, nor specific reduction targets or climate pledges outlined. Without concrete figures or commitments, it is challenging to assess their carbon footprint or climate strategy.
